写点什么

Node.js 0.8 发布,更快更稳定

  • 2012-07-03
  • 本文字数:539 字

    阅读完需:约 2 分钟

Node.js 0.8 发布了。新版本的 Node 更快、更稳定,在 Cluster 模块有了重大改进,另外还添加了新的 Domain 模块和基于 GYP 的新版构建系统。

从 node 团队分享的性能基础测试来看,Node 0.80 性能比上一个稳定版0.6.19(node 使用的版本控制模式中奇数版本为不稳定版本)提升了近200%。速度提升体现在吞吐量和读/ 写操作方面。node 团队指出,大部分的性能提升归功于 V8 的改善:

他们(V8 团队)对于 Node.js 项目响应非常积极。Node 的大部分成功都归功于构建在这样一个优秀的 VM 之上。

新版本往 Cluster 模块添加了一些新特性,并让已有特性如今变得更快和更稳定。部分特性与文件描述符相关,后者原本在 0.6 版本中弃用,而现在又以某种形式重新回归。新的 Domain 模块可以聚合多个 IO 特性,并且更有效地处理崩溃。

Node 还添加了一个新的构建系统, GYP 。GYP 可根据目标生成 Makefile、Visual Studio 项目文件或 XCode 文件,最近它也被 V8 和 Chrome 吸纳。其实,Node 从 0.6 版本就在 windows 中使用 GYP,只是在其他地方使用的是 WAF

你可以从 node wiki 中查看完整的 API 改动细节,可以在 nodejs 博客中查看发布公告。另外,请注意最新稳定版本为0.81,该版本出现在0.80发布4 天之后,加入了一些小的改动。

查看英文原文: Node Gets Faster, More Stable

2012-07-03 08:393052
用户头像

发布了 125 篇内容, 共 42.6 次阅读, 收获喜欢 5 次。

关注

评论

发布
暂无评论
发现更多内容

浅谈Android网络通信的前世今生--网络基础,深度剖析原理

android 程序员 移动开发

深入探索 Android 内存优化(炼狱级别-上),安卓消息分发机制

android 程序员 移动开发

深入解析Android的StateListDrawable,【工作感悟】

android 程序员 移动开发

用最通俗简单的方式,带你全面理解Android事件传递机制,有一句废话你砍我

android 程序员 移动开发

深入学习-Gradle-自动化构建技术(五)Gradle-插件架构实现原理剖析-

android 程序员 移动开发

深入浅出,Andorid 端屏幕采集技术实践(1),android面试题整理最新

android 程序员 移动开发

深入浅出:MVVM+ViewBinding,互联网寒冬公司倒闭后

android 程序员 移动开发

炸裂!万字长文拿下HTTP 我在鹅厂等你!,入职阿里啦

android 程序员 移动开发

热修复设计之热修复原理(三),kotlin后端框架

android 程序员 移动开发

熟悉Android打包编译的流程,超硬核

android 程序员 移动开发

流媒体协议之WebRTC实现p2p视频通话(二),kotlin数组转集合

android 程序员 移动开发

深入Android系统 Binder-2-使用,阿里P7亲自讲解

android 程序员 移动开发

独立开发者为什么,不需要运营也能月薪几万,甚至几十万?

android 程序员 移动开发

王者荣耀MVP-不不不,一个小例子彻底搞懂Android的-MVP到底是什么

android 程序员 移动开发

滴滴DoKit Android核心原理揭秘之函数耗时,android组件化

android 程序员 移动开发

炸裂!万字长文拿下HTTP 我在鹅厂等你!(1),html5移动开发框架

android 程序员 移动开发

浅谈ConcurrentHashMap,android游戏开发大全第二版代码

android 程序员 移动开发

深入探索编译插桩技术(三、解密 JVM 字节码,都是精髓

android 程序员 移动开发

深入Flutter TextField,android开发流程图

android 程序员 移动开发

深入RecyclerView学习—缓存机制,kotlin带参数的单例模式

android 程序员 移动开发

深入探索 Android 内存优化(炼狱级别-上)(1),2021年最新Android面试点梳理

android 程序员 移动开发

深入浅出,Andorid 端屏幕采集技术实践,附大厂真题面经

android 程序员 移动开发

深入理解Flutter动画原理,安卓framework

android 程序员 移动开发

温故知新:深入理解Android插件化技术,Android高级插件化强化实战

android 程序员 移动开发

没有对象怎么面向对象编程呢?真让人头秃!,sharedpreferences跨进程

android 程序员 移动开发

注意!关于怎么理解 onStart可见但不可交互,程序员千万不要小瞧了这个问题

android 程序员 移动开发

深入理解 RecyclerView 的绘制流程和滑动原理,android应用开发教程答案

android 程序员 移动开发

热修复——Tinker的集成与使用,android系统工程师面试题

android 程序员 移动开发

玩转Android事件分发机制,kotlinnative内存管理

android 程序员 移动开发

浅析NestedScrolling嵌套滑动机制之实践篇-仿写饿了么商家详情页

android 程序员 移动开发

深入探索 Android 网络优化(二、网络优化基础篇,移动开发框架

android 程序员 移动开发

Node.js 0.8发布,更快更稳定_架构/框架_Roopesh Shenoy_InfoQ精选文章